Output d8118bcbba23e10de095c4de381753ff60ff99c5f8fb6bbb6f18b00b8ae061af:13

value
194904625
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0aac68529bd987583bb63ae7d8676f607e3b40e1 OP_EQUAL
address
32fTDYceTWYZXFjoQJRw5xYW97dRLHumRH
transaction
d8118bcbba23e10de095c4de381753ff60ff99c5f8fb6bbb6f18b00b8ae061af
spent
true